« Black hole physics and astrophysics with LISA »

Scott Hughes
Massachusetts Inst. Technology (MIT) (Cambridge, Massachusetts, Etats-Unis d'Amérique)

The space-based gravitational wave detector LISA is currently under development as a joint NASA-ESA mission for launch around 2013. The sensitivity of this antenna is designed to be optimal for waves arising from processes involving black holes with masses of 10^5 - (a few) 10^7 solar masses --- nicely aligned with the low end of the mass function of black holes observed at the cores of most galaxies. In this talk, I will discuss what we can learn about these black holes from LISA observations.
